Human Resource Director will lead and direct routine functions of Human Resource (HR) department- including hiring and interviewing staff, administering pay, benefits and leave.

Supervisory Responsibilities:

  • Recruit, interview, hire and train new staff in department.
  • Oversee daily workflow of department.
  • Supervises Human Resources Assistant.

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Oversee recruitment of employees, and ensure adherence to established policies and procedures.
  • Oversee orientation of new employees and ensure adherence to established policies and procedures.
  • Sends out updates to personnel policies and other HR information to employees.
  • Manages individual employee benefits, reconciles, and prepares reports.
  • Serves as Plan Administrator for retirement account.
  • Responsible for annual 1095-c reporting and filing.
  • Prepares payroll change information for payroll clerk, reviews and approves payroll for processing.
  • Maintains electronic and physical employee files.
  • Responsible for all benefit and compensation management.
  • Maintains the staff directory.
  • Work with Executive Director to strategically plan for future human resource needs- compensation, staffing levels, education, space, etc.
  • Develop and recommend policy and procedures to the Executive Director.
  • Responsible for preparing renewals for all general and health insurance.
  • Reconcile workers comp premiums and compile Workers Comp Audit annually.
  • Assist with emergency management, planning, and deliverables.
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.

Education and Experience: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Human Resources or related field preferred
  • Successful applicant should have a human resources administrator background that includes a minimum three years of experience in an administrative accounting role.
  • College-level course work in human resources and/or accounting fields or any combination of education, training and experience which demonstrates the ability to perform the duties of the position.
  • Three years human resource experience preferred.
